Burke Lake Recreation Area offers a serene prairie retreat just 2 miles east of Burke, South Dakota, along US Highway 18. Nestled across 206 acres, this scenic destination features a pristine 25-acre lake surrounded by trees, native prairie grasses, and wildflowers, creating a peaceful oasis in the South Dakota landscape. The recreation area caters to outdoor enthusiasts with diverse water activities including boating, canoeing, kayaking, and fishing from well-maintained piers. Anglers and water sports lovers will find excellent opportunities on the lake, while hiking trails wind through the property for those seeking exploration on foot. The campground provides 15 first-come, first-served campsites with essential amenities including drinking water access, picnic tables, grills, and vault toilet facilities. Boating enthusiasts benefit from the boat ramp and fishing pier infrastructure, all designed to be ADA-accessible. The area welcomes pets and provides ample space for family gatherings with a group picnic shelter available.
